MMC emerge as strong contender for AFC Cup qualifiers
By a Staff Reporter
Kathmandu - Manang Marshyangdi Club have emerged as a strong contender to participate in the AFC Cup qualifiers after defeating Nepal Police Club 3-1 at Pokhara Stadium during their Qatar Airways Martyrs Memorial A Division League match on Saturday.
With the victory, MMC have climbed atop the points table. The top team after completion of the seventh round matches will feature in the AFC Cup qualifiers. The outcomes of the next two rounds of matches will decide which team will get the opportunity to participate in the qualifiers.
